CRUCIFERAE, proper noun. An alternative name for Brassicaceae. A taxonomic family within the order Brassicales — the mustard or cabbage family.
Dictionary definition
CRUCIFERAE, noun. A large family of plants with four-petaled flowers; includes mustards, cabbages, broccoli, turnips, cresses, and their many relatives.
